Choi Woo-beom “DRX match, I was neither a manager nor a player”

OK Savings Bank Brion coach Choi Woo-beom evaluated the DRX game as “neither the manager nor the players”.

OK Savings Bank lost 0-2 to DRX in the 9th week of the 2023 ‘LoL Champions Korea (LCK)’ summer season regular league held at the LCK Arena in Jongno-gu, Seoul on the 3rd. As a result, OK Savings Bank recorded 4 wins and 13 losses (-17), confirming their elimination from the playoffs.

Head Coach Choi, who held a press conference after the game, gave a general review of the game, saying, “I was neither a manager nor a player.” He said, “I usually come to the stadium with high expectations, but I thought it wouldn’t be easy today as my performance wasn’t good recently.” I was helpless,” he said.

Losing 3 games in a row and crying at the end of the season at the lack of support. Coach Choi said, “Recent performances and scrims were not good,” and “I felt like I was back at the beginning of the season.” Coach Choi expressed regret, saying, “I felt similar to the period when I lost in a row from the end of the spring season to the beginning of the summer season.”

He lamented the team's lack of ability to carry out Plan B. Director Choi said, “There are picks that we are good at. When they are banned, the performance is not very good,” he said. “In the second round, the first set was won a lot. But in the next set, if the opponent bans us in line with our preparations, our performance seems to drop a lot. There is a big difference between dealing with a champion that handles well and a champion that doesn’t.”

OK Savings Bank will play the last game of the season against Gen.G on the 5th. Director Choi said, “Gen.G is a tough opponent, but we are pros. He said, “I will do my best to set the mood.” “Of course we want to win,” he said. It's just not going well,” he said. “The players check here will be more desperate than me. The season is almost over, so I hope the players will face it with confidence, regardless of win or loss.”
